Analysis of the surname 'Parrilli' across different countries reveals a varied incidence rate. According to recent data, the surname is more prevalent in the United States, Argentina, and Italy. Each country's statistics reflect a unique narrative of migration and settlement, showcasing how the surname has trailed its bearers across continents.
In the United States, 'Parrilli' holds an incidence rate of 522. The surname's presence in the U.S. may have evolved through immigration, likely from Italian or Argentine populations. The melting pot nature of America has historically welcomed individuals from various backgrounds, thus allowing names such as 'Parrilli' to thrive.
Argentina features a significant incidence of 'Parrilli' at 152. The influx of Italian immigrants to Argentina during the late 19th and early 20th centuries contributed to the dissemination of various Italian surnames, and 'Parrilli' is among those that made the journey. The Italian community in Argentina is one of the largest in the world outside of Italy, creating a unique cultural blend that has cemented surnames like 'Parrilli' into the Argentine identity.
With an incidence rate of 74, Italy is where the surname 'Parrilli' likely has its deepest roots. Besides the three primary countries—U.S., Argentina, and Italy—'Parrilli' appears with lower incidence rates in several other nations. Brazil has 22 instances, reflecting another migration pattern, likely due to Italian immigrants and their descendants. The surname has also reached countries such as Belgium, Venezuela, Germany, Canada, Spain, Senegal, Switzerland, Estonia, Great Britain, India, Luxembourg, and Mexico, although with much lower frequencies.
